The following information is for oily, sensitive, pigmented and wrinkled facial skin. Look for these ingredients in the skin care products you buy to get the maximum benefits.

Good Skin Care Ingredients

1. To lessen acne:

- Benzoyl peroxide
- Retinol
- Salicylic acid (beta hydroxy acid, or BHA)
- Tea tree oil
- Zinc

2. To reduce inflammation:

- Aloe vera
- Arnica
- Calendula
- Chamomile
- Colloidal oatmeal
- Cucumber
- Dexpanthenol (pro-vitamin B5)
- Epilobium
- Feverfew
- Green tea
- Licochalone
- Perilla leaf extract
- Pycnogenol (a pine bark extract)
- Red algae
- Thyme
- Evening primrose oil
- Trifolium pretence (red clover)
- Zinc

3. To prevent or lighten dark spots:

- Arbutin
- Bearberry extract
- Cucumber
- Glycyrrhiza glabra (licorice extract)
- Hydroquinone
- Mulberry extract
- Niacinamide

4. To prevent wrinkles:

- Alpha lipoic acid
- Basil
- Caffeine
- Carrot extract
- Copper peptide
- Coenzyme Q10
- Cucumber
- Curcumin (tetrahydracurcumin or turmeric)
- Ferulic acid
- Feverfew
- Ginger
- Ginseng
- Grape seed extract
- Green tea, white tea
- Idebenone
- Lutein
- Lycopene
- Pomegranate
- Pycnogenol (a pine bark extract)
- Rosemary
- Silymarin
- Trifolium pretense, fabaceae (red clover)
- Yucca

Skin Care Ingredients to Avoid

1. If you get acne regularly:

- Cinnamon oil
- Cocoa butter
- Cocos nucifera (coconut oil)
- Isopropyl isostearate
- Isopropyl myristate
- Peppermint oil
- Sodium laurel sulfate

2. Sunscreen ingredients to avoid

If you are sensitive to sunscreen:

- Avobenzone
- Benzophenones (such as oxybenzone)
- Methoxy cinnamate (often found in waterproof sunscreens, can cause a reaction)
- Para-aminobenzoic acid (PABA)
